In this episode of More Yourself, I wanted to share a clip from a recent ADHD Women's Wellbeing live session that explored the concept of generativity versus stagnation —a theme that is very prevalent among late-diagnosed ADHD women.

This concept, rooted in Erik Erikson’s psychosocial development theory, invites us to reflect on how we create meaning and contribute to our own lives and to others as we move through the different stages of adulthood. For those of us who received a diagnosis later in life, this understanding can be transformative. It reminds us that our diagnosis isn’t the end, it’s the beginning of a new chapter.

What I discuss:

• Erikson’s 8 stages of psychosocial development viewed through a neurodivergent lens. • The impact of unconscious masking on ADHD traits and energy levels. • The concept of generativity vs. stagnation for late-diagnosed ADHD women. • Seeing a late diagnosis as a new chapter for authenticity and evolution. • The role of meaningful connection in women's reconnection with their identity post-diagnosis. • The power of embracing change in midlife and beyond.
